The Model After the Interface
When AI stops waiting inside a chat box, the design problem becomes how it enters the world without taking it over.
The chat box gave artificial intelligence a useful boundary. We ask; it answers. Agentic software dissolves that line. It reads calendars, opens tools, modifies files, and communicates with other systems.
Conversation was the prototype
Chat made complex models legible, but many tasks are really sequences of state changes with permissions, dependencies, and consequences. The next interface must show what an agent believes, which resources it can reach, what it plans to change, and where a person can intervene.
Agency needs shape
Good agent design will feel like working beside a careful operator. Reversible actions can happen quickly. Irreversible actions should become visible checkpoints. Uncertainty should alter behavior, not merely add a disclaimer.
The decisive product will make autonomy understandable when the user is distracted, the data is incomplete, and a small mistake can travel a long way.
